Core Viewpoint - The successful completion of the bridge rotation in Yiyang marks a new phase of "refined and intelligent" traffic construction in the region, enhancing connectivity and reducing congestion [1][2] Group 1: Project Details - The bridge on Wuyuan Road spans the Beijing-Guangzhou Railway and was rotated 68.8° in 58 minutes during a scheduled maintenance window [1] - The bridge features a dual six-lane design with a width of 31.6 meters and a designed speed of 40 km/h, aimed at alleviating congestion on National Highway 107 [1] - The bridge's railway section is 202 meters long, with a T-shaped structure length of 124 meters, utilizing an innovative "construction first, rotation later" method [1] Group 2: Construction Techniques - The construction site is located in a karst geological area, necessitating high safety and precision standards [1] - The construction team employed advanced techniques such as pre-drilling to ensure stability and safety, akin to performing a CT scan of the underground conditions [1] - During the rotation, a fiber optic sensing system and Beidou positioning technology were used to monitor and control the process, ensuring smooth operation without disrupting railway services [1] Group 3: Future Plans - Following the rotation, the next steps include closing the hinge and completing the mid-span by January 20, 2026, with plans to open the bridge to traffic by January 31, 2026 [2] - The project aims to create a "5-minute commuting circle" between the new and old urban areas of Yiyang, facilitating regional industrial integration and improving residents' quality of life [2]
